Movies:
The Brave Little Toaster Goes to Mars (video) - Ceiling Fan (voice) - Year: 1998
Edie & Pen - Actress - Year: 1997
Thumbelina - Ms. Fieldmouse (voice) - Year: 1994
Happily Ever After - Muddy (voice) - Year: 1993
Sgt. Pepper's Lonely Hearts Club Band - Our Guests at Heartland - Year: 1978
Shinbone Alley - Mehitabel (voice) - Year: 1971
Skidoo - Flo Banks - Year: 1968
All About People (short) - Narrator - Year: 1967
Thoroughly Modern Millie - Muzzy - Year: 1967
The First Traveling Saleslady - Molly Wade - Year: 1956
Paid in Full - Mrs. Peters - Year: 1950
The Addams Family (TV series) - Granny (voice) - Year: 1992
Where's Waldo? (TV series) - Additional Voices (voice) - Year: 1991
Alice in Wonderland (TV movie) - White Queen - Year: 1985
The Royal Variety Performance 1979 (TV movie) - Actress - Year: 1979
58th Annual Tony Awards (TV special) - Presenter for Best Original Score - Year: 2004
Himself/Herself:Broadway: The Golden Age, by the Legends Who Were There (documentary) - Herself - Year: 2003
Homo Heights - Herself (uncredited) - Year: 1998
The Line King: The Al Hirschfeld Story (documentary) - Herself - Year: 1996
Broadway at the Hollywood Bowl (TV special) - Herself - Year: 1994
JFK: The Day the Nation Cried (TV documentary) - Herself (attended JFK inaugural) - Year: 1989
George Burns - His Wit and Wisdom (video) - Herself - Year: 1989
Circus of the Stars #12 (TV special documentary) - Performer - Year: 1987
Night of 100 Stars (TV special) - Herself - Year: 1982
The 24th Annual Grammy Awards (TV special) - Actress - Year: 1982
The 34th Annual Tony Awards (TV special) - Herself - Presenter - Year: 1980
The 32nd Annual Tony Awards (TV special) - Herself - Year: 1978
Free to Be... You & Me (TV movie) - Herself (voice) - Year: 1974
Carol Channing's Los Angeles - Herself - Year: 1966
The 19th Annual Tony Awards (documentary) - Herself - Presenter - Year: 1965
